Q77e-ETH. Term limits for Prime Minister should be added (Q77E_ETH)

Data file: eth_r8.data_new_final_wtd_release_31mar21.sav

Overview

Valid: 2378
Invalid: -
Minimum: 1
Maximum: 9
Type: Discrete
Decimal: 0
Start: 731
End: 732
Width: 2
Range: 1 - 9
Format: Numeric

Questions and instructions

Literal question
77-ETH. A number of proposals have been made about how Ethiopia should amend or replace some provisions in the current Constitution. Would you support or oppose each of the following proposed changes to the Ethiopian Constitution, or haven’t you heard enough to say?
E. A provision requiring term limits for the Prime Minister should be added.
Categories
Value Category Cases
-1 Missing 0
0%
1 Strongly oppose 143
6%
2 Oppose 403
16.9%
3 Neither support nor oppose 132
5.6%
4 Support 862
36.2%
5 Strongly support 765
32.2%
8 Refused 0
0%
9 Don’t know 73
3.1%
Warning: these figures indicate the number of cases found in the data file. They cannot be interpreted as summary statistics of the population of interest.
